    • Handbags and Gladrags. Rod Stewart - Handbags & Gladrags (1969) [HQ+Lyrics] Manfred Mann's Mike D'Abo wrote this song, with Chris Farlowe releasing the first version.
    • Have I Told You Lately. Rod Stewart_have i told you lately (MTV Unplugged) Van Morrison first recorded this song in 1989, and Rod later performed his own version two years later.
    • This Old Heart of Mine. Rod Stewart - This Old Heart Of Mine. This track was originally a hit for The Isley Brothers in 1966. Nine years later, Rod scored a hit with a cover version of the song.
    • Da Ya Think I'm Sexy? Rod Stewart - Da Ya Think I'm Sexy? (Official Video) Rod fully embraced the disco era with this number one song from 1978, even if it was intended as something of a disco spoof.
